We took glass jars and filled them with water. Now, Took two onion bulb and place one on each jar. a) What will be the observation in the roots of the onion after 2 to 4 days? b) What tissue is present in the tip of the root? c) Where is this tissue present other than tips of roots? d) What happens if the tips of the roots cut?​

a)When glass jars are filled with water and onion bulbs are placed inside, small white roots will emerge from the bottom of each onion bulb within 2 to 4 days. These roots will continue to grow longer as time passes.

b)The tissue present in the tip of the root is known as the apical meristem. This particular region is responsible for cell division and the growth and development of the root.

c)Apart from being present in the tips of roots, the apical meristem tissue can also be found in the tips of shoots in all plants. It plays a crucial role in the growth of the plant's length.

d)Cutting the tips of the roots will temporarily halt the growth of the roots as the apical meristem is removed. However, the plant will eventually develop new apical meristems and resume growing. This may affect the growth rate of the plant, and the root system may become more branched.
